About Putnam Heights Elementary
Putnam Heights Elementary is a regular public school located in Eau Claire, Wisconsin, enrolling 422 students from kindergarten through fifth grade. The school boasts a student-teacher ratio of 12.4:1 and has 34 full-time equivalent teachers dedicated to providing quality education. Located in the heart of a small city, Putnam Heights Elementary offers a warm and nurturing environment for young learners.
Academically, Putnam Heights Elementary holds a MySchoolScout rating of 6.0 out of 10, placing it at the 61st percentile among Wisconsin schools with a state ranking of #828 out of 2112. The school's ELA/Reading proficiency rate stands at 49%, and in Math, 50% of students are proficient or above. While there is room for academic growth, Putnam Heights Elementary focuses on student development and supports its diverse learning community.

Community Profile
The community surrounding Putnam Heights Elementary has a median household income of $71,406. It is a well-educated community where 42%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The median home value in the area is $265,000, with a median rent of $963/month. The area has a poverty rate of 10.2%. Residents enjoy a short average commute of 17 minutes. Source: U.S. Census ACS 2022 5-Year Estimates.
